Amram

Hastings' Dictionary of the Bible

AMRAM . 1 . A Levite, son of Kohath and grandson of Levi ( Num 3:17-19 , 1 Chronicles 6:2-3; 1 Chronicles 6:18 ). He married Jochebed his father’s sister, by whom he begat Aaron and Moses ( Exodus 6:18-20 ) and Miriam ( Numbers 26:59 , 1 Chronicles 6:3 ). The Amramites are mentioned in Numbers 3:27 , 1 Chronicles 26:23 . 1 Chronicles 26:2 . A son of Bani who had contracted a foreign marriage ( Ezra 10:34 ).
